WINC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2019 in Review

6 of the 4,605 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Western Asset Short Duration Income ETF (WINC) for Q2 2019, worth a combined $24.6M — up 0.02% from $24.6M a quarter earlier.

Fund positioning in WINC was balanced in Q2 2019: 1 fund opened new positions, 1 closed out, 0 added to existing stakes and 1 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Bay Colony Advisors, opening a new position worth an estimated $295K. The largest seller was Jane Street, exiting entirely with an estimated $442K sold.
